Golden Cross Confirmed: Do Gland Pharma Ltd's Other Technical Indicators Agree?
The 50-day moving average has crossed above the 200-day moving average for Gland Pharma Ltd, signalling a golden cross on 29 May 2026. Yet, the stock declined 2.75% on the day the cross formed, while monthly momentum indicators remain mildly bearish. This juxtaposition of signals invites a closer examination of the technical and fundamental context surrounding the event.

Are Gland Pharma Ltd latest results good or bad?
Gland Pharma Ltd's Q4 FY26 results are strong, with a net profit of ₹366.68 crores and a 22.31% revenue growth, but concerns remain about the sustainability of high operating margins and recent declines in quarter-on-quarter growth. Overall, the performance is impressive, yet the company needs to demonstrate consistent results to maintain investor confidence.
